What Exactly is a Megachef Immersion Circulation Precision Sous Vide Cooker?
The term “sous vide” (pronounced “soo-veed”) literally means “under vacuum” in French. It refers to a cooking method where food is sealed in a vacuum-safe bag and then cooked in a precisely controlled water bath. The Megachef immersion circulation precision sous vide cooker is the heart of this process. It’s a compact, powerful device that clips onto virtually any pot or container, transforming it into a high-tech cooking vessel.
This isn’t just any heater; it’s an immersion circulator. It works by drawing water from your pot, heating it to an exact temperature you set, and then circulating it evenly throughout the bath. This constant movement ensures there are no hot or cold spots, guaranteeing that every part of your food cooks uniformly. The “precision” aspect means it maintains this temperature with incredible accuracy, often within a fraction of a degree, making overcooking virtually impossible. It’s the secret weapon for achieving that coveted perfect doneness every single time. Unwavering Consistency and Edge-to-Edge Perfection
One of the greatest struggles in traditional cooking is achieving consistent doneness. Think about searing a steak: the outside gets beautifully browned, but the internal temperature can vary, leading to a gradient of well-done edges and a rare center. With sous vide, this problem vanishes. Because the water bath temperature is precisely maintained at your desired final internal temperature, your food cooks evenly from edge to edge. Whether it’s a medium-rare steak or a perfectly poached egg, the result is always exactly what you intended, without fail.
Flavor, Moisture, and Nutrient Retention Like Never Before
When food is sealed in a vacuum bag and cooked gently in a water bath, its natural juices and flavors have nowhere to escape. Unlike methods where moisture evaporates or nutrients leach out into boiling water, sous vide locks everything in. This means your meats are incredibly juicy, your vegetables retain their vibrant taste and nutrients, and any marinades or seasonings you add truly infuse into the food, creating a depth of flavor that’s hard to achieve otherwise.

Understanding Your Megachef Immersion Circulator: How It Works
At its core, your Megachef immersion circulation precision sous vide cooker is an ingenious piece of engineering. Here’s a quick look under the hood:
It consists of a heating element, a powerful pump or impeller, an accurate temperature probe, and a digital control panel. Once you clip it to your cooking vessel and fill it with water, you set your desired temperature and cooking time using the intuitive digital display. The device then begins to heat the water to that exact temperature. The pump continuously circulates the water, ensuring that every drop in the bath is at the identical temperature. The temperature probe constantly monitors the water, and the control circuitry precisely regulates the heating element, turning it on and off as needed to maintain that perfect, stable temperature throughout your cooking cycle. This constant circulation is key to preventing temperature variations, which would lead to unevenly cooked food.
Getting Started with Your Megachef Immersion Circulation Precision Sous Vide Cooker
Ready to dive in? Using your Megachef immersion circulation precision sous vide cooker is simpler than you might think.
- Basic Setup: Attach your sous vide cooker to a sturdy pot or a dedicated sous vide container. Fill it with water, ensuring the water level is between the minimum and maximum fill lines indicated on your device.
- Preparing Your Food: Season your food generously. Place it in a high-quality, food-safe bag. While a vacuum sealer is ideal for removing air and creating a tight seal, you can also use a heavy-duty zip-top bag with the “water displacement method.” To do this, slowly lower your bag (with food inside) into the water bath, allowing the water pressure to push out the air before sealing the bag just above the waterline.
- Setting Time and Temperature: Use the digital touchscreen on your Megachef to set the precise temperature for your desired doneness. Consult a reliable sous vide time and temperature chart for guidance. Then, set your cooking timer.
- The “Finishing” Touch: For most proteins, once the sous vide cooking is complete, you’ll want to remove the food from the bag, pat it thoroughly dry, and give it a quick sear in a hot pan, on a grill, or with a culinary torch. This creates a beautiful, flavorful crust that enhances both texture and taste.
Mastering Your Megachef: Tips and Recipes for Success
To get the most out of your Megachef immersion circulation precision sous vide cooker, keep these tips in mind:
- Dry Your Food for Better Searing: Patting proteins extremely dry with paper towels before searing is crucial for achieving that irresistible golden-brown crust. Moisture is the enemy of a good sear!
- Prevent Evaporation: For longer cooks, cover your water bath with plastic wrap, aluminum foil, or a pot lid with a cutout for your circulator. This prevents water from evaporating and ensures your water level stays consistent, which is vital for safe and effective cooking.
- Experiment with Seasonings: Sous vide is fantastic for infusing flavors. Add fresh herbs, garlic, citrus slices, or a pat of butter directly into the bag with your food before sealing. Be mindful with salt; some chefs prefer to salt after the sous vide bath to prevent drawing out too much moisture during long cooks.
- Consider an Ice Bath: If you’re cooking in advance and plan to chill food for later, move the sealed bag directly from the hot water bath to an ice bath. This rapidly cools the food, ensuring it passes through the temperature danger zone quickly and safely.
Quick Recipe Ideas:
- Perfect Medium-Rare Steak: Set your Megachef to 130°F (54.5°C). Cook a 1.5-inch thick steak for 1.5-2 hours. Finish with a high-heat sear for 1-2 minutes per side.
- Juicy Chicken Breast: Set to 145°F (63°C). Cook boneless, skinless chicken breasts for 1.5-2 hours. Pat dry and sear briefly for a golden exterior.
- Fluffy Poached Eggs: Set to 145°F (63°C). Cook eggs (still in their shells!) for 45 minutes to 1 hour for a perfect, jammy yolk.
Keeping Your Precision Cooker Pristine: Cleaning and Maintenance
Regular care will ensure your Megachef immersion circulation precision sous vide cooker serves you well for years.
- Daily Wipe-Down: After each use, allow the device to cool completely. Wipe down the exterior with a damp cloth.
- Cleaning the Sleeve/Heating Coil: Many immersion circulators have a removable sleeve around the heating element. Remove it and gently clean any residue. You can use a soft brush or sponge.
- Descaling: Over time, mineral deposits from your tap water can build up on the heating element, especially in hard water areas. To descale, fill a pot with water and a 50/50 mixture of white vinegar. Immerse your Megachef and run it at 140°F (60°C) for about 30 minutes. Rinse thoroughly afterwards. Always refer to your user manual for specific cleaning instructions.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Is sous vide cooking safe?
Absolutely! Sous vide cooking is incredibly safe because it maintains precise temperatures that can pasteurize food, killing harmful bacteria without overcooking. The sealed bag also prevents contamination.
What kind of bags should I use for sous vide?
You should use food-grade, BPA-free bags specifically designed for sous vide or vacuum sealing. Heavy-duty zip-top freezer bags (not sandwich bags) can also work for many recipes, especially with the water displacement method.
Can I use any pot with my Megachef immersion circulation precision sous vide cooker?
Yes, one of the great advantages of an immersion circulator is its adaptability. You can use almost any heat-safe pot, container, or even a cooler, as long as it’s deep enough to allow the device to be immersed to its minimum fill line and hold your food.
Does sous vide cooking take a long time?
Some sous vide cooks can be lengthy (hours or even days for tough cuts), but many common items like steak, chicken, fish, and vegetables cook within 1-2 hours. The “long” part is hands-off time, which is a major convenience.
What foods are best for sous vide?
Sous vide excels with proteins like steak, chicken, pork, and fish, ensuring perfect doneness. It’s also fantastic for eggs, tender vegetables, and even custards or infusing liquids. Essentially, anything where precise temperature control makes a difference in texture and tenderness benefits greatly.
